Student tests positive for COVID at Madison Elementary School, no other students or staff affected

Student tests positive for COVID at Madison Elementary School, no other students or staff affected The Desert Sands Unified School District announced that there was a positive COVID case at James Madison Elementary School in Indio earlier this week. DSUSD s Assistant Superintendent of Student Services Laura Fisher confirmed that no students or staff were deemed close contacts, due to all the masks and distancing guidelines in place. There will be no quarantines for students or staff. Fisher says the student will be isolated for 10 days and return to school after meeting the required return to school criteria, which falls in line with the California Department of Public Health.

Newsom pushes to reopen California public schools but faces resistance

Jocelyn Gecker, Janie Har and Amy Taxin Associated Press Gov. Gavin Newsom said Wednesday that all California schools should reopen when the new academic year begins next fall. His frustration was evident: “Money is not an object now. It’s an excuse, he said. “I want all schools to reopen. I’ve been crystal clear about that.” Newsom spoke at an elementary school in Santa Rosa that began welcoming students back this week. But his wishes remain an expectation rather than a mandate in California’s decentralized education system, where 1,200 school districts negotiate separately with teachers unions and ultimately govern themselves.
